I've been thinking about your problem and while I have no experience with crow creek bows I really think you should give Cari-bows another look. Abe is a true artist and craftsman as well as being a heck of a nice guy and yes his bows are expensive but worth every penny. If you go with a plain jane Silver Fox without all the fancy options you won't pay much more than you would for a top end production bow like a Tomahawk or top end Martin. My 49# Siver Fox spits out a 450 gr arrow at 189 fps wereas a 60# tomahawk SS only achieved 170 fps. Now speed isn't every thing but it is a measure of performance. Sometimes Abe gets cancelled orders or has some bows in stock I think it would be worth your time to phone him and see what he has. There is a reason you don't see any used Cari-bows on the market ounce you have one you will never part with it and probably won't shoot anything else. Good Luck and have fun    Delin
